It's the end of an era as Mike moves on to his new life in Iowa. For his last show, we're trying some beer from Chicago's Is/Was with our buddy Chad Ramey. We hope you enjoy it, and we'll be back in 2 weeks.

  • Levain
  • Maestro
  • Flat & Point Collaboration Series Vol 1
  • Window Fishing
  • The Finer Points of Bad Behavior Vol 5.5
